    RabiThose tables you were mentioning, SYS_EXPORT_SCHEMA_nn , are the data pump master tables used for data pump jobs;their purpose is to
    hold the info about the job details.
    Once the job has finished table should be droped, but in case of a job failure table remains so every new dp job must create new SYS_EXPORT_SCHEMA_nn table
    with the +1 nn iteration depending on the name of the last master table that was left due to the dp job failure.
    Cleaning those tables can be done with the dbms_datapump STOP_JOB Procedure, check the docs about the details :
    http://download.oracle.com/docs/cd/B12037_01/server.101/b10825/dp_export.htm
    You can also go visit youroracle support to see examples and instructions for cleaning your db from those dismised master tables,
    How To Cleanup Orphaned DataPump Jobs In DBA_DATAPUMP_JOBS ? [ID 336014.1]

    the first problem about Adapter Configuration failed during installation is a bug. This problem happens in case the installer is not able to get the short path name for LINK_DIR and while submitting the command for configuring the Adapter the command is having spaces in the path resulting in incorrect command which is failing
    check the di_0.log installer log file in <BOE_HOME>\BusinessObjects Enterprise 12.0\logging folder, open  this file in notepad and search for following text
    com.acta.adapter.sdkutil.UpdateAdapterVersion
    you will see a error like java.lang.NoClassDefFoundError: Objects\BusinessObjects
    if you are not using Adapters then this is not a problem for you, your installation is fine, you should be able to use other functions
    The second issue with SNMP, the error message says "The port may be in use by another process", check if the port 4001 is avilable ? try with a different port number

  • Is there a way to create tables that can't update rows

    Hi
    I have an application where security is very importante. I have tables that con only be inserted and queried, not updated or deleted. Is there a way I can tell Oracle to prohibit update and delete on that table.
    Regards,
    Néstor Boscán

    > Is there a way I can tell Oracle to prohibit update and delete on that table.
    Yes. Quite easy in fact. It is called FGAC - Fine Grained Access Control.
    You create a FGAC function for those tables. These simply returns 1=2 to be added to an UPDATE or DELETE statement's predicate.
    Example:
    SQL> -- am able to delete from emp
    SQL> delete from emp;
    17 rows deleted.
    SQL> rollback;
    Rollback complete.
    SQL>
    SQL> -- create policy FGAC function
    SQL> create or replace function vpdbPolicy( schema varchar2, object varchar2 ) return varchar2 is
    2 begin
    3 return( '1=2' );
    4 end;
    5 /
    Function created.
    SQL>
    SQL> -- create FGAC policy
    SQL> begin
    2 DBMS_RLS.add_policy(
    3 object_schema => USER,
    4 function_schema => USER,
    5 object_name => 'emp',
    6 policy_name => 'PROTECT_EMP',
    7 policy_function => 'vpdbPolicy',
    8 update_check => FALSE,
    9 statement_types => 'UPDATE DELETE'
    10 );
    11 end;
    12 /
    PL/SQL procedure successfully completed.
    SQL>
    SQL> -- no longer able to delete from emp
    SQL> delete from emp;
    0 rows deleted.
    SQL> rollback;
    Rollback complete.
    SQL>
